Transaction df952564f20501f64c0963b1a7982bd1f3f07c2852d9669eeaad1a90d2e000ba
1 Input
1 Output
-
df952564f20501f64c0963b1a7982bd1f3f07c2852d9669eeaad1a90d2e000ba:0
- value
- 413900
- script pubkey
- OP_0 OP_PUSHBYTES_20 efb01b638d3007fd3df515aa53ebe0b49a740fe6
- address
- bc1qa7cpkcudxqrl6004zk4986lqkjd8grlxdp04nm